Startup Test Page

LaserWriter II printers generate a startup test page approximately 2-3 minutes after you switch on the printer.

Except for the IISC, the startup test page also shows unit-specific configuration information. The following pages describe each element of the startup test page.

IISC Startup Test Page

The LaserWriter IISC test page consists only of vertical lines. The printer will generate a test page only if its SCSI address has been set to 7 prior to powering up.

Note: Be sure to set the SCSI address back before you resume printing.
